Which of the following statements describes how atomic size increases in the periodic table?

A. Down a column (group)
B. Up a column (group)
C. Across a row from left to right (period)

Final answer:

Atomic size increases down a group and decreases across a period in the periodic table.


Explanation:

Atomic size increases down a group due to added energy levels and shielding from the nucleus. Conversely, atomic size decreases from left to right across a period as there is increased nuclear pull on the valence electrons.
